Transaction 3c37f81475794b6786de6f5c26fb148ec75c5222ef023b9f033d81624a3033ea
1 Input
1 Output
-
3c37f81475794b6786de6f5c26fb148ec75c5222ef023b9f033d81624a3033ea:0
- value
- 254646985
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e599d87c5e81ab3f2424fa2b26f9c01f924d6d99 OP_EQUAL
- address
- 3Nd2xrba9Wo81p17ah7peZrAFtAMkraZiu